Asbestos has long been known for its fire-resistant properties and has been extensively used in building materials, significantly in roofing. However, its hazardous nature implies that any residence containing asbestos requires particular consideration, significantly throughout renovations or repairs. Knowing how to safely remove asbestos roof materials is critical to making sure the security of yourself and others - Professional Asbestos Roof Disposal.


Prior to tackling any asbestos removal project, it’s essential to establish whether or not your roof incorporates asbestos. Homes built before the late Eighties are extra likely to have asbestos-containing materials. Inspecting the roof might require skilled assist, notably if you discover any indicators of injury or deterioration. If you're confident that asbestos is current, it is prudent to consult with an asbestos abatement specialist.


Preparation is an important first step within the removal process. You'll need to obtain the correct private protective tools (PPE), together with an asbestos-rated respirator, disposable coveralls, gloves, and eye safety. This gear protects you from inhaling any fibers that could be released in the course of the removal process.

Creating a controlled setting is another vital step. Before starting any work, seal off the realm to forestall asbestos fibers from spreading into your home and surrounding environment. This may contain using plastic sheeting to cowl doors, windows, and vents. Turning off air-con systems also can minimize the chance of contamination.


It’s usually recommended to strategy this course of on a day with little to no wind. Wind can carry asbestos fibers into the air, increasing the chance of publicity not only for you however for neighbors as nicely. Take your time to make sure the realm is as safe as attainable before proceeding to take away any materials.

The precise removal process ought to be accomplished rigorously and deliberately. Using a water spray may help to dampen the asbestos materials as you're employed, decreasing the probability of airborne fibers. However, it’s essential to keep away from aggressive methods, like ripping or tearing, as these can create debris and launch fibers into the air.


During the removal, acquire any debris in heavy-duty plastic luggage designed for hazardous materials. Seal each bag tightly to forestall any fibers from escaping. Label each bag clearly, indicating that it accommodates asbestos. This minimizes risks during transportation and disposal. Storing collected materials in a safe location until disposal is also essential to attenuate exposure.


Disposing of asbestos materials should never be accomplished casually. Many localities have specific regulations regarding asbestos waste disposal. Generally, it'll require transporting the materials to a delegated hazardous waste facility. It’s vital to observe all native laws and guidelines to ensure compliance and safety.

After the removal and disposal are full, it is important to conduct thorough cleansing. Use wet cleaning methods rather than dry sweeping, because the latter can launch any trapped fibers into the air. After cleansing, it could be clever to have an air quality evaluation carried out to confirm that no dangerous materials remain.


In conditions the place the task feels overwhelming, reaching out to a professional asbestos abatement agency is advisable. They have the training, instruments, and expertise essential to soundly perform these procedures. Their expertise can save time and ultimately shield your health.

  • Prioritize an intensive inspection of the roof to identify asbestos presence and situation before proceeding with removal efforts.

  • Ensure all essential personal protecting tools (PPE), including respirators, gloves, and disposable coveralls, are worn to minimize exposure.

  • Create a containment area by sealing off the work zone with plastic sheeting to stop asbestos fibers from dispersing into the surrounding surroundings.

  • Wet the asbestos materials thoroughly before removal to scale back the risk of airborne fibers and reduce mud during the process.

  • Use specialized instruments designed for asbestos removal to avoid breaking the material into smaller pieces, which can launch hazardous fibers into the air.

  • Properly label all removed asbestos materials and place them in permitted, leak-tight containers for transportation to a certified disposal website.

  • Adhere strictly to native regulations and guidelines regarding asbestos removal and disposal to make sure compliance and public security.

  • Conduct air quality monitoring during and after removal to ensure that no asbestos fibers stay in the air, confirming a protected setting.

  • Engage licensed asbestos removal contractors with experience in dealing with hazardous materials, as they follow established security protocols and regulations.
